Description

A kind of liquid medicine for jewelry degumming
Technical field
The present invention relates to jewelry arts, more specifically, it relates to a kind of liquid medicine for jewelry degumming.
Background technique
The jewelry list of narrow sense refers to that jade, the jewelry of broad sense should include gold, silver and natural material (mineral, rock, life Object etc.) it is made, it is the jewellery with certain values, craftwork or other collections.Jewelry mainly plays the effect of decoration.
In order to make the appearance of jewelry more rich and varied, improve the decorative effect of jewelry, it will usually to the appearance of jewelry into Row dyeing processing.But the dyeing of jewelry is usually that part is dyed, therefore is needed during jewelry dyeing to achromophil Part covers.Existing technology is usually to coat polyurethane glue to protect, after dyeing in achromophil part The polyurethane glue for being covered on not coloured portions is struck off again.
But during striking off polyurethane glue, the dynamics struck off is difficult to hold, may accidentally by jewelry The coating of the part of dyeing is hung, and causes the aesthetic effect of jewelry appearance to be affected, still there is improved space.
Summary of the invention
In view of the deficiencies of the prior art, the present invention intends to provide a kind of liquid medicine for jewelry degumming, tool Have convenient for degumming, be conducive to the advantages of protecting the aesthetic effect of jewelry appearance.
To achieve the above object, the present invention provides the following technical scheme that
A kind of liquid medicine for jewelry degumming, the component including following mass fraction:
45-60 parts of methylene chloride;
45-60 parts of trichloro ethylene;
Polyacrylate adsorbs resin 7.5-10 parts;
7.5-10 parts of butanone;
15-20 parts of dihydric alcohol;
22.5-30 parts of pure water.
By adopting the above technical scheme, polyurethane glue has good dissolubility in butanone, will be on jewelry using butanone Polyurethane glue dissolution so that the removal process of polyurethane glue is not easy to influence the dyed part of jewelry, to make The aesthetic effect for obtaining jewelry appearance is not readily susceptible to influence;Methylene chloride has the advantages that solvability is strong and toxicity is low, trichlorine Ethylene is good solvent, is conducive to the rate of dissolution for accelerating polyurethane glue, so that polyurethane glue dissolution is more complete, is reduced Polyurethane glue is easy the case where being retained in jewelry surface and influencing appearance, meanwhile, butanone is also that acrylic acid absorption resin is good Solvent, be conducive to improve liquid medicine in each component compatibility so that the stability of liquid medicine enhances;Polyacrylate absorption tree Rouge has excellent adsorptivity, and polyacrylate absorption resin is middle polarity adsorbent, and both adsorbable polar substances could also Apolar substance is adsorbed, so that the peculiar smell of the ingredient volatilization of irritant smell is easy to be adsorbed in liquid medicine, reduces liquid medicine Volatile ingredient be easy the case where impacting to the health of human body, meanwhile, butanone and methylene chloride all have hypotoxicity, have Conducive to the environmental-protecting performance for improving liquid medicine, so that liquid medicine is not easy to impact the health of operator;In addition, the ammonia in polyurethane Carbamate group is also easy to carry out ester exchange reaction with dihydric alcohol, generates polyalcohol carbamate compound, polyalcohol Contain polyurethane structural in carbamate compound, also act as coating and adhesive, the coating of polyurethane structural with And adhesive has the characteristics that excellent wearability, excellent chemicals-resistant, oil resistivity and adhesive force are strong, so that jewelry After impregnating degumming in liquid medicine, jewelry surface is easy covering layer protecting film, is conducive to carry out the dyeing coating layer of jewelry surface Protection, so that dyeing coating layer is not easy to be damaged, so that the aesthetic effect of jewelry appearance is not readily susceptible to influence;Meanwhile Toxic isocyanate groups are not contained in polyalcohol carbamate compound, so that protective film is not allowed to be also easy to produce Noxious material, and then be conducive to improve the environmental-protecting performance of jewelry, so that the protective film of jewelry surface is not easy to cause human health It influences.
The present invention is further arranged to: the mass ratio of the methylene chloride and trichloro ethylene is 1:1.
By adopting the above technical scheme, the setting for being 1:1 by the mass ratio of methylene chloride and trichloro ethylene, is conducive to improve The dissolved efficiency of methylene chloride, trichloro ethylene and butanone, so that polyurethane glue dissolution is more complete, so that liquid medicine Colloidal sol effect improves, and reduces polyurethane glue and is easy to be retained in the case where jewelry surface influences appearance;Meanwhile being conducive to polyurethane After glue is completely dissolved, liquid medicine is covered on jewelry surface to form protective film, so that covering efficiency improves.
The present invention is further arranged to: further include the component of following mass fraction:
3.75-5 parts of methanol.
By adopting the above technical scheme, by the way that methanol is added, methanol is a kind of good solvent, is conducive to improve each in liquid medicine The compatibility of component, so that the stability of liquid medicine improves;Meanwhile methanol is alternatively arranged as the elution of polyacrylate absorption resin Agent, so that the adsorbent of polyacrylate absorption resin is eluted out, to be conducive to polyacrylate absorption resin It recycles.
The present invention is further arranged to: further include the component of following mass fraction:
1.5-2 parts of thickener.
By adopting the above technical scheme, by the way that thickener is added, be conducive to the consistency for enhancing liquid medicine, so that jewelry is in liquid medicine After impregnating degumming, liquid medicine is easier to be attached to jewelry surface to form protective film, so that the carry out be conducive to jewelry is better Protection, so that the aesthetic effect of jewelry appearance is more preferable.
The present invention is further arranged to: the thickener is cellulose thickener.
It by adopting the above technical scheme, is the setting of cellulose thickener by thickener, due to cellulose thickener Thickening mechanism be by the winding of strand to realize what viscosity improved, in static or low shearing speed, cellulosic molecule Make system that high viscosity be presented in disordered state, and in high shear rates, molecule is parallel to flow direction and makees ordered arrangement, It is easy to mutually slide, so system viscosity declines, so that jewelry when dissolving polyurethane glue, can make by stirring liquid medicine The consistency for obtaining liquid medicine reduces, so that jewelry comes into full contact with liquid medicine, is conducive to the abundant dissolution of polyurethane glue, and when poly- After the dissolution completely of urethane glue, jewelry can be statically placed in liquid medicine, so that the consistency of liquid medicine increases, and then be conducive to liquid medicine attachment In jewelry surface to form protective film.
The present invention is further arranged to: the thickener is methylcellulose.
It by adopting the above technical scheme, is the setting of methylcellulose by thickener, film formed by methylcellulose has Excellent toughness, flexibility and transparency, to be conducive to the protection film strength that enhancing is attached to jewelry surface, so that protection Film is not easy to be damaged, and then is conducive to protect the appearance of jewelry, meanwhile, transparent protective film is not easy to jewelry Appearance has an impact, and is conducive to jewelry surface and keeps aesthetic effect.
The present invention is further arranged to: further include the component of following mass fraction:
Vinyl acetate -1.5-2 parts of acrylate polymer.
By adopting the above technical scheme, by the way that vinyl acetate-acrylate polymer is added, due to vinyl acetate-acrylic acid There is good adhesion strength between ester polymer and jewelry, be conducive to the adhesive force for enhancing liquid medicine and jewelry, so that jewelry impregnates In liquid medicine after complete degumming, liquid medicine is easier to be attached to jewelry surface to form protective film;In addition, according to the similar original to mix Then, vinyl acetate-acrylate polymer and polyacrylate absorption resin have similar functional group, so that acetic acid second There is good compatibility between alkene-acrylate polymer and polyacrylate absorption resin, and then be conducive to improve liquid medicine The compatibility of middle each component, so that the stability of liquid medicine improves.
The present invention is further arranged to: further include the component of following mass fraction:
0.75-1 parts of brightener.
By adopting the above technical scheme, by addition brightener, be conducive to the cleanliness and glossiness that increase protection film surface, So that the polishing effect of protection film surface improves, be conducive to the dicoration for increasing jewelry surface.

Specific embodiment
With reference to embodiments, invention is further described in detail.
In the examples below, it is the trade mark of Chemical Co., Ltd. for MB- that polyacrylate absorption resin, which uses Shanghai long, 2660 acrylic resin.
In the examples below, the mass percent of the acrylate in vinyl acetate-acrylate polymer is 35%.
In the examples below, brightener uses the brightener of the model S-83F of Shanghai De Yu get trade Co., Ltd.
Embodiment 1
A kind of liquid medicine for jewelry degumming, the component including following mass fraction:
Methylene chloride 45kg;Trichloro ethylene 45kg;Acrylate adsorbs resin 7.5kg;Butanone 7.5kg;Dihydric alcohol 15kg; Pure water 22.5kg.
In the present embodiment, dihydric alcohol is ethylene glycol, in other embodiments, dihydric alcohol can also for 1,3-PD, 1,4-butanediol, 1,3-BDO, 2,3-butanediol, Isosorbide-5-Nitrae-pentanediol etc..
Liquid medicine for jewelry degumming the preparation method is as follows:
(1) in 200L stirred tank, under normal temperature condition, pure water 22.5kg is added, is stirred with the revolving speed of 40r/min It mixes;
(2) methylene chloride 45kg, trichloro ethylene 45kg are added while stirring, stirs evenly, obtains pre-composition;
(3) acrylate absorption resin 7.5kg, butanone 7.5kg, ethylene glycol 15kg, stirring are added when stirring pre-composition Uniformly to get the liquid medicine for jewelry degumming.

Experiment 1
Prepare the consistent 200ml container of 9 shape sizes and 9 consistent jewelry of shape size, 9 shape sizes one The cladding thickness of the dyeing site of the jewelry of cause, the position of polyurethane glue covering and polyurethane glue is consistent, respectively to 9 The embodiment 1-6 and comparative example 1-3 liquid medicine obtained for being used for jewelry degumming is poured into the container of a 200ml, in normal temperature condition Under, 9 jewelry are put into the liquid medicine of container respectively, after 10min, jewelry is taken out and observes and records the polyurethane glue on jewelry Residual quantity.
Experiment 2
The jewelry taken out in experiment 1 is continued to be returned in corresponding container and be immersed in liquid medicine, shakes polyurethane adhesive Water is completely dissolved polyurethane glue, after the polyurethane glue covered on jewelry is completely dissolved, jewelry is taken out and is cleaned, to After the polyurethane glue of all jewelry surfaces is completely dissolved and cleans, then jewelry is returned in corresponding container, 10min Afterwards, the overlay capacity that jewelry observes and records the protective film covered on jewelry is taken out.
Table 1
Table 2
It can be obtained according to embodiment 1-3 in table 1 and table 2 and the data comparison of comparative example 1, by the way that butanone, polyurethane is added Glue in butanone there is good dissolubility to be conducive to jewelry table so that polyurethane glue is easy to be dissolved in liquid medicine The polyurethane glue of face covering is completely dissolved, so that the residual quantity of polyurethane glue is reduced on jewelry, so that polyurethane glue Removal process is not easy to influence the dyed part of jewelry, so that the appearance of jewelry is not readily susceptible to influence;Together When, the carbamate groups in polyurethane are also easy to and dihydric alcohol carries out ester exchange reaction, generate polyalcohol carbamate Class compound contains polyurethane structural on polyalcohol carbamate compound, so that polyalcohol carbamates Compound also has the function of coating and adhesive, since polyurethane structural also has wear-resisting property, chemical-resistance, oil resistant Performance and the strong feature of adhesive force, so that liquid medicine is easy to form protective film in jewelry surface, so that the guarantor of jewelry surface The overlay capacity of cuticula increases, and then is conducive to protect the dyeing coating layer of jewelry appearance, so that the dyeing of jewelry surface applies Layer is not readily susceptible to damage, so that the appearance of jewelry is not readily susceptible to influence.
It can be obtained according to the data comparison of embodiment 1-3 and comparative example 2-3 in table 1 and table 2, pass through methylene chloride and trichlorine The mass ratio of ethylene is the setting of 1:1, is conducive to improve solution rate of the polyurethane glue in liquid medicine, so that polyurethane glue Dissolved in liquid medicine more complete, to advantageously reduce the remaining polyurethane adhesive water of jewelry surface;Meanwhile it also helping Liquid medicine is improved in the covering efficiency of jewelry surface, so that liquid medicine is easier to be formed in jewelry surface and protect after polyurethane glue dissolution Cuticula is conducive to protect the dyeing coating layer of jewelry surface, have so that the protective film overlay capacity of jewelry surface increases Good appearance is kept conducive to jewelry surface.
It can be obtained according to the data comparison of embodiment 1-3 in table 2 and embodiment 4-6, it, can be to a certain degree by the way that methanol is added The upper solubility for improving polyurethane glue in liquid medicine, so that the residual quantity of polyurethane glue is reduced;By the way that Methyl cellulose is added Element and vinyl acetate-acrylic copolymer, can enhance the adhesive force between liquid medicine and jewelry, so that medicine to a certain extent Water is easier to be attached to form protective film on jewelry, so that the protective film overlay capacity of jewelry surface increases.
